EXHIBIT C 70] Northpoinl Parkway, Suite 205 West Palm Beach, FL 33407 Returned £0: Town of 1,,oxahaichce Groves 155 F Rd Loxahatchee Groves, FL 33470 SPECIAL MAGISTRATE HEARING TOWN OF LOXAHA'I‘CHEE GROVES, FLORIDA (561) 793-24 18 TOWN OF LOXAHATCHEE GROVES, FLORIDA, CASE NO. CE«25-15 Petitioner, J & J REALTY INVESTMENT HOLDINGS LLC, Respondent. / ORDER FINDING VIOLATION AND DELINQUENCY AND ASSESSING FINES AND PENALTIES RE: Violation of Soclions 22-1 32, 22-134 and 22435 of the Code ofOrdinancos of the Town of Loxahatchoc Groves. LEGAL DESCRIPTION LOXAHATCHEE GROVES TR 37 (LESS W 1450. 14 FT & E 50.02 ADDL FOLSOM RD R/W) BLK F STREET ADDRESS: 1555 Folsom Road Loxahatchee Groves, Florida 33470 PARCEL CONTROL NUMBER: 4 l —4 l ~43- 1 7—01 ~637—OO I 0 Tho Code Enforcement Special Magistrate heard testimony at the Code Enforcement Special Magistrate Hearing held on the 81h day of September, 2025 regarding the above-referenced case and based on the evidence presented at that hearing, enters the following Findings of Fact, Conclusiona of Law and Ordeit Page l 0f3 FINDINGS OF FACT Rcspondeni, J & J REALTY INVESTMENT HOLDINGS LLC, is the owner of the abovc~ described property. Respondent was not present at the hearing; however, there was a finding Ofproper noiicc. Documentation and/or evidence was produced at the September 8, 2025 hearing indicating that the Respondent has not paid the Business Tax imposed by the Town of Loxahatchee Groves for the preceding years ot‘2023 and 2024 and such tax is now deiinquent beyond 150 days after the initiai notice of tax due. The Town’s documentary and/or photographic evidence were entered into the record as Composite Exhibit 1 without objection. CONCLUSIONS OF LAW The aboveestated facts constitute a vioiation of Sections 22~l32, 22-134 and 22—135 of the Code ofOi-dinances of the Town of Loxahatchee Groves and subjects Respondent to penalties as set forth at Chapter 205, FS ORDER Pursuant to Section 205.053(2), F.S., Respondent is delinquent in the payment of the required Business Taxes which were due on September 30, 2023 and September 30, 2024 and have been assessed the maximum delinquency penalty of up to twenty~live percent (25%) of the tax due in addition to any other penalty provided by law or ordinance. It is hereby Ordered that the Respondent pay the required Business Tax due in the amount of One Hundred Dollars ($100.00) for 2023 pursuant to Sections 22—l32, 22-134 and 22~l35 of the Code of Ordinances of the Town of Loxahatohee Groves, plus a penalty of twenty—five percent (25%) ofthe tax due in accordance Section 205.053(2), F,S., equal to Twenty~Five Dollars ($25.00), for the year 2023. lt is further Ordered that the Respondent pay the required Business Tax due in the amount of One Hundred Dollars ($100.00) for 2024 pursuant to Sections 22~l32, 22-134 and 22-l35 of the Code of Ordinances ofthe Town of Loxahatchee Groves, plus a penalty oftwenty—five percent (25%) of the tax due in accordance Section 205.053(2), F.S., equal to Twenty~Five Dollars ($25.00), for the year 2024. Accordingly, Respondent is hereby assessed a total tax and penalty amount due of $250.00, all in accordance with Section 205.053, F.S.
